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Dog size and breed compatibility: Select a collar with adjustable sensitivity ranges and appropriate weight limits to ensure safe training for small, medium, and large dogs.
  • Sensor technology: Dual-sensor systems (sound and vibration) help reduce false positives from ambient noise. AI-driven chips provide more precise recognition for humane training.
  • Correction modes: Look for a mix of beep, vibration, and adjustable static correction. Some models offer auto-sleep or safety pause features to prevent over-correction.
  • Waterproof rating: Outdoor use and swimming require IPX7 or IPX8 waterproof protection to maintain performance in rain or splashes.
  • Range and multi-dog capability: For outdoor training, a longer remote range is beneficial. If you have more than one dog, consider dual-channel remotes or buy extra collars separately.
  • Durability and safety: A robust design with comfortable collars, smooth correction levels, and no remote control misfires helps ensure consistent training outcomes without distress.
  • Setup and maintenance: Easy setup, clear manuals, and rechargeable batteries reduce downtime and encourage regular use as part of a training routine.
  • Ethical considerations: Use collars as training aids, not punishment. Start with the lowest effective level and closely monitor your dog’s stress signals.
